Stephen Blackehart

'Stephen Blackehart' (born 1 December 1967 in New York City) is an American actor and producer from Hell's Kitchen, New York. Blackehart is most known for playing Benny Que in the cult classic film Tromeo and Juliet, but he has also acted in many other low-budget B-movies, such as Rockabilly Vampire, Retro Puppet Master and Death Racers. In addition to his film work, Blackehart has acted in such TV series as Grey's Anatomy, The Big Apple, and as Lt. Pa'ak in Star Trek: Deep Space Nine. He was a regular on the BBC's The Tromaville Cafe, where he originated the role of Felix, the French Trickster. Most recently Blackehart produced Jenna Fischer's mockumentary film LolliLove.
